Richard Fitzwilliam 1415–1478 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1415
Birth Location: Wadworth, Yorkshire, England
Death Date: 22 SEP 1478
Death Location: Sprotborough, Yorks, England
Father: Edmond Fitzwilliam
Mother: Catherine Clifton
Spouse(s): Elizabeth Clarell
Children(s): Isabel Fitzwilliam
The story of Richard Fitzwilliam began in 1415 in Wadworth, Yorkshire, England. Richard Fitzwilliam married Elizabeth Clarell, and had children including Isabel Fitzwilliam. Richard Fitzwilliam passed away in 1478 in Sprotborough, Yorks, England.
